Tancak Tulis is a waterfall tourist destination located on the western slope of
Mount Argopuro. This area is a production forest zone and is classified as a
protected forest. Butterflies (Lepidoptera: Papilionoidea) are among the insects
found in this area. Observations of butterfly community structure and flower
preferences aim to understand species composition, particularly in the Tancak
Tulis area, which has not been extensively studied to date. This research was
conducted from July 2025 to March 2026. Sampling locations were determined
using purposive sampling in two habitat types: rubber plantations and coffee
plantations. The sampling technique used was road sampling. Community
structure analysis included the Shannon-Wiener diversity index, richness index,
evenness index, dominance index, and similarity index. Species identification was
based on relevant literature. A total of 20 species were identified from four
families: Ypthima horsfieldii, Ypthima nigricans, Euploea mulciber, Euploea
tulliolus, Melanitis leda, Mycalesis horsfieldii, Neptis hylas, Hypolimnas bolina,
Eurema hecabe, Leptosia nina, Delias hyparete, Pareronia valeria, Appias
lyncida, Appias olferna, Catopsilia pomona, Papilio memnon, Papilio polytes,
Troides helena, Graphium sarpedon, and Nacaduba kurava. The most dominant
species were Eurema hecabe and Ypthima nigricans. The community structure
index (H’) with a value of 2.34 was categorized as moderate; (R), with a value of
2.34, is categorized as moderate; (E), with a value of 0.57, is categorized as high;
(D), with a value of 0.13, is categorized as low; (SI), with a value of 78.79%, is
categorized as high; (Rdi) indicates moderate abundance, with the species
Eurema hecabe having the highest abundance. Most butterflies visit purple,
yellow, and blue flowers with tubular shapes. The average validation score for
this book is 88.6, categorized as very good.
